Location: atlanta | My daughter Kaki has put together a 10 city tour of the Southeast in November. The shows will be solo performances by her with various stringed instruments including her signature Adamas, a miniature 12 string, a harp guitar, and a fan-fretted 7 string nylon. Here are the venues, dates and cities:
11/3 - The ArtsCenter | Carrboro, NC
11/4 - The Handlebar | Greenville, SC
11/6 - The Pour House | Charleston, SC
11/10 - Capitol Theatre | Tampa, FL (Clearwater))
11/11 - Downtown Concert Series | Miami, FL
11/12 - Plaza Live | Orlando, FL
11/14 - WorkPlay | Birmingham, AL
11/16 - State Theatre | Starkville, MS
11/17 - Barking Legs Theater | Chattanooga, TN
11/19 - The Loft | Atlanta, GA
